在Python中,apply
函数已经被废弃,可以使用apply
函数的替代方法是使用applymap
、apply
、map
等函数。
applymap
函数:对DataFrame中的所有元素应用函数df.applymap(func)
apply
函数:对DataFrame中的每一列或每一行应用函数df.apply(func, axis=0) # 对每一列应用函数
df.apply(func, axis=1) # 对每一行应用函数
map
函数:对Series中的每个元素应用函数s.map(func)
这些函数可以替代apply
函数的功能,并且更加灵活和高效。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
相关推荐:apply函数在Python中的替代者